Bellingham’s older homes. many built with wood framing in the early 1900s. are particularly susceptible to carpenter ants. The damp Pacific Northwest climate softens wood over time, making it easier for carpenter ants to excavate galleries and nest inside walls, crawl spaces, and attic structures. Unlike many other ants, carpenter ants don’t eat wood. they hollow it out for nesting, causing significant structural damage over time. Annual exterior barrier treatments are the most effective preventive measure for homes in these neighbourhoods.

Properties bordering green spaces, wooded areas, and water sources face elevated pressure from several pests. Rodents. particularly roof rats. travel along tree lines and enter homes through gaps near roof lines and utility penetrations. Carpenter ants nest in nearby stumps and decaying wood and forage into homes. Yellow jackets frequently build underground nests on wooded lots. And spiders, drawn by abundant insect populations, are year-round presences. A recurring exterior treatment plan is the most effective defense for properties in these areas.
